BQ Exclusive: DHFL Lenders Seek RBI Approval To Take Over A Portion Of The Company

DHFL lenders forced to take the last option, after company’s debt resolution plan fails to lure them.

Lenders to the beleaguered Dewan Housing Finance Corporation Ltd. have decided to proceed with a contingency plan which involves them taking over at least a part of the company’s operations.
